🚚 The Local Picture

With Stevenage ideally located near major transport links like the A1(M) and the M25, it’s a prime spot for logistics and transport firms. But competition for qualified drivers is fierce, and businesses need to stand out.

Building a reputation as a reliable and supportive employer—one that listens to its drivers and rewards their hard work—is key to long-term success.
